Cordova District Library Board of Trustees met November 9.

Here is the minutes provided by the Board:

The meeting was called to order at 6:30 pm by Debra Deines, Vice President. Some board members may be attending electronically.

Trustees in attendance: Mark Barnes, Debra Deines, Karen Lonergan, Audrey Roman, and Regina Skipper. Absent: Debra Hart and Merredith Peterson.

Sue Hebel/Library Director and Cheryl Lennox/Head Librarian were in attendance.

No public present.

The minutes from the October meeting were presented. Karen Lonergan made a motion to accept the minutes as read and was seconded by Regina Skipper. Motion carried.

The minutes from the October Closed Session were presented. Audrey Roman made a motion to accept the minutes as read and was seconded by Mark Barnes. Motion carried.

Secretary’s Report: Sue Hebel read a note from Deb Hart thanking the Library Board for the flowers in memory of her father.

President’s Report: No report

Treasurer’s Report: Karen Lonergan presented the financials for the month. Karen Lonergan made a motion to accept the Treasurer’s report and pay the bills. Regina Skipper seconded. Motion carried.

Be It Further Resolved that the payments made by the District, under the signatures of the President, Treasurer, or Director, as detailed in the Financial Report presented and approved as necessary to meet the obligations of the District in timely manner.

Director’s Report: Sue Hebel reported:

• An updated contact list of Library Trustees was distributed.

• Sue will be on vacation December 4-8th.

• The Per Capita Grant came out this week. It will be due January 15, 2018. The Disaster Plan is to be worked on and updated.

• The Delegates Assembly was attended with Karen Lonergan on October 25th. Delegates Assembly meets quarterly each year.

• The first session of Director’s Boot Camp was attended by Merredith Peterson, Mark Barnes, Karen Lonergan and Sue Hebel. Two more sessions are scheduled for November 13th and 20th from 1:30 – 3:00.

Librarian’s Report: Cheryl Lennox reported:

• Cheryl’s last day of work will be December 20, 2017

• The November/December newsletter was sent.

• Christmas decorations are up. Thank you Library Friends for helping.

• Two parties are on the calendar for December: The children’s party is planned for December 21st at 5:00. A Grinch themed party is planned by employees, Jade Crisp and Rachel Ellicott. The annual Christmas Open House is planned for December 14th from 1:00-6:00. Music will be provided by the Davenport Chordbusters and Riverdale students. It was decided that the Cordova Library Board Trustees will plan the food.

Reports:

Finance:

The Budget and Appropriations Ordinance #2017-04 was discussed. Per Library Law, the library is required to tax at.15 of accessed evaluation of the library district. Motion was made by Karen Lonergan, seconded by Audrey Roman that the Budget and Appropriations Ordinance be accepted as presented. Motion passed.

The motion to approve hiring of Karen Lonergan as the new Cordova Library Director was made by Audrey Roman and seconded by Regina Skipper. Beginning salary of $40,000 per year and a 90 day review. Motion carried.

Personnel Strategic Plan: No report

Policy: No report

Policy Strategic Plan: No report

Buildings & Grounds: Sue Hebel reported:

• The sidewalk project bid is $5968.00. The Village will pay $3000.00 towards this project. Freelance Landscaping is scheduled to begin work on November 10, 2017. The shrub removal bid is $1884.00.

• The building was cleaned by American Window Cleaning.

• The trees on the green space have been removed. The bill will be paid when the area is cleaned up as per the bid.

Building & Ground Strategic Plan: No report

Technology: Sue Hebel reported:

• “Your Desk Away From Home” has been created for patron use. A document scanner and bed scanner are available in a more personal work space with computer and supplies.
